How Our Team Handles Water Heater Leak Water Removal
When you call us for water heater leak water removal, you can expect a swift and efficient response from our team. We know that every minute counts in these situations, and that’s why we’ll arrive quickly and get to work assessing the damage. Our process involves a series of steps designed to get your home dry and safe as soon as possible.
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our team will arrive at your property and assess the damage caused by the water heater leak. We’ll identify the source of the leak and contain the affected area to prevent further water dam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use a combination of pumps and wet vacuums to extract as much water as possible from your property. This is a critical step in preventing further damage and reducing the risk of mold and mildew growth.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Next, we’ll use industrial-grade dehumidifiers and fans to dry your property thoroughly. This step is crucial in preventing mold and mildew growth, which can lead to health hazards and further damage.
Step 4: Cleaning and Disinfection
Once your property is dry, we’ll clean and disinfect all surfaces to prevent the growth of bacteria and other microorganisms. This step is essential in ensuring your home is safe and healthy to inhabit.
Step 5: Restoration and Reconstruction
Finally, we’ll work with you to restore and reconstruct your property to its original condition. This may involve repairing or replacing damaged materials, such as drywall, flooring, and cabinets.

Water Heater Leak Water Removal Cost In Ivanhoe, CA
The cost of water heater leak water removal in Ivanhoe, CA, varies depending on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. These estimates are based on real-world scenarios and should give you a rough idea of what to expect.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of leak, and equipment needed |
| Restoration and reconstruction | $2,000 – $10,000 | Materials needed, labor required, and complexity of repairs |
| Dehumidification and drying |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, severity of leak, and equipment needed |
| Disinfection and cleaning |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, severity of leak, and equipment needed |
